What is the chain of custody form?

The chain of custody form is a crucial document used to track the handling of evidence or property throughout its lifecycle. This form ensures that any items collected, such as physical evidence in legal cases, are properly documented and preserved. By maintaining a clear record of who handled the items, when they were handled, and how they were stored, the chain of custody form helps establish the integrity of the evidence. This is essential in legal proceedings, as it can affect the admissibility of evidence in court.

Key elements of the chain of custody form

A well-structured chain of custody form includes several key elements that are vital for its effectiveness. These elements typically consist of:

  • Case Information: Details about the case, including the case number and the type of evidence.
  • Item Description: A clear description of the evidence or property, including serial numbers or unique identifiers.
  • Collection Details: Information about when and where the item was collected, along with the name of the person who collected it.
  • Transfer Records: Documentation of each transfer of the item, including the names of individuals involved and the dates of transfer.
  • Storage Information: Notes on where the item is stored and under what conditions, ensuring proper preservation.

Legal use of the chain of custody form

The legal use of the chain of custody form is paramount in ensuring that evidence remains admissible in court. Courts require a clear chain of custody to establish that the evidence has not been tampered with or altered. Failure to maintain a proper chain of custody can lead to evidence being deemed inadmissible. Therefore, it is essential to follow legal guidelines and best practices when completing and maintaining the chain of custody form.

Examples of using the chain of custody forms

Examples of using chain of custody forms can be found in various contexts, such as:

  • Criminal Investigations: Documenting evidence collected at a crime scene, such as fingerprints or weapons.
  • Forensic Analysis: Tracking samples sent to laboratories for analysis, ensuring they remain untampered.
  • Property Management: Maintaining records of items held as evidence in civil cases, such as property disputes.

Years ago I worked at document management company.  There is cool software that can automate aspects of hand-written forms.  We had an airport as a customer - they scanned plenty and (as I said before) this was several years ago...On your airport customs forms, the "boxes" that you 'need' to write on - are basically invisible to the scanner - but are used because then us humans will tend to write neater and clearer which make sit easier to recognize with a computer.  Any characters with less than X% accuracy based on a recognition engine are flagged and shown as an image zoomed into the particular character so a human operator can then say "that is an "A".   This way, you can rapidly go through most forms and output it to say - an SQL database, complete with link to original image of the form you filled in.If you see "black boxes" at three corners of the document - it is likely set up for scanning (they help to identify and orient the page digitally).  If there is a unique barcode on the document somewhere I would theorize there is an even higher likelihood of it being scanned - the document is of enough value to be printed individually which costs more, which means it is likely going to be used on the capture side.   (I've noticed in the past in Bahamas and some other Caribbean islands they use these sorts of capture mechanisms, but they have far fewer people entering than the US does everyday)The real answer is: it depends.  Depending on each country and its policies and procedures.  Generally I would be surprised if they scanned and held onto the paper.   In the US, they proably file those for a set period of time then destroy them, perhaps mining them for some data about travellers. In the end,  I suspect the "paper-to-data capture" likelihood of customs forms ranges somewhere on a spectrum like this:Third world Customs Guy has paper to show he did his job, paper gets thrown out at end of shift. ------>  We keep all the papers! everything is scanned as you pass by customs and unique barcodes identify which flight/gate/area the form was handed out at, so we co-ordinate with cameras in the airport and have captured your image.  We also know exactly how much vodka you brought into the country. :)
